The text is famous for introducing specific Hatha Yogic concepts that are now standard in modern yoga.
The 10 Yamas and 10 Niyamas: While Patanjali lists 5 of each, Gorakhnath expands these into 10 ethical restraints (Yamas) and 10 observances (Niyamas). These include non-violence, truthfulness, celibacy, forgiveness, and cleanliness.

Unlike a modern novel, the Goraksha Samhita is a scripture. Its "story" is a conversation about the liberation of the human soul.
The Setting: The text is set in a timeless ancient India, amidst the ascetics of the Nath Siddha tradition. The legend goes that Matsyendranath (the founder of the Nath sect) had been initiated into the secrets of Yoga by Shiva himself. However, Matsyendranath fell into the temptations of worldly life in the "Kingdom of Women" and forgot his divine purpose.
The Rescue: Gorakhnath, the most beloved disciple of Matsyendranath, realized his guru was trapped. To rescue him, Gorakhnath entered the kingdom disguised as a dancing girl. Through his yogic powers and wisdom, he reminded Matsyendranath of his true nature. Upon being saved, Matsyendranath imparted the highest teachings to Gorakhnath. Unlike later texts that sometimes overlook cleansing techniques, the Goraksha Samhita dedicates significant space to the Shatkarmas: Neti (nasal cleansing), Dhauti (stomach cleansing), Nauli (abdominal churning), Basti (colon cleansing), Kapalabhati (skull shining), and Trataka (concentrated gazing).
